I had them made for me.....they are a pair of 20 BA drivers IEM, 10 BA per side- 2 bass, 2 lower-mids, 2 upper-mids, 2 highs and 2 super highs
.
I have had them for about six weeks, sound really good and I will be bringing them back to have them re-shelled in to customs.........

Are your D2Ks modded? If so, how do they compare to the LCD-2s?
D2k's are stock. The D2k's have more bass response. I listen to them about 80% of the time. I love them, but it is a real treat when I listen to the LCD-2's. They are much more detailed through the mids and highs.
I pretty much use the D2k's for casual listening, Gaming, Hip-Hop and Electronic music and I use the LCD-2's for everything else.
I didn't want to mod the D2k's that's why I got the LCD-2's. Now I have the best of both worlds.
